The original price of an item was $20.00. It was marked up 25%. What is the new selling price?
Gre4nikov [31]

Answer:

$25

Step-by-step explanation:

Multiply $20 by 0.25 (which is 25% as a decimal)

$20 x 0.25 = $5

Add $5 to $20 which makes the answer $25

Simplify: (7+2a)·3–20 =
Black_prince [1.1K]
<h2>Greetings!</h2>

Answer:

6a + 1

Step-by-step explanation:

First, you need to multiply everything in the brackets by 3L

(7 + 2a) x 3 =

7 * 3 = 21

2a *  3 = 6a

21 + 6a

Now you can subtract the 20 from this:

6a + 21 - 20

Simplified down:

6a + 1
